Maritime surveillance plays a pivotal role in strengthening naval capabilities and expanding the Anti Submarine Warfare Market. As submarine technology becomes increasingly stealthy and sophisticated, continuous monitoring of maritime domains has become essential for early threat detection. Surveillance systems serve as the first layer of defense, providing situational awareness across territorial waters and international sea lanes.

Modern navies rely heavily on integrated maritime surveillance systems that combine radar, satellite tracking, sonar networks, and airborne monitoring. These systems provide real-time data, enabling command centers to detect unusual underwater activity and respond promptly. By merging data from surface ships, submarines, and aircraft, surveillance networks ensure comprehensive maritime visibility.

One major advancement is the deployment of unmanned systems. Autonomous underwater vehicles (AUVs) and unmanned surface vessels (USVs) are increasingly used for persistent monitoring. These platforms reduce human risk while expanding operational coverage. When integrated with AI-based analytics, surveillance systems can identify potential threats faster and more accurately.

Geopolitical tensions and territorial disputes in regions such as the South China Sea and the North Atlantic have intensified the need for enhanced maritime monitoring. Countries are investing in coastal sonar arrays and underwater sensor grids to protect strategic assets and shipping routes.

North America leads in maritime surveillance innovation due to its strong defense infrastructure and technological expertise. Europe continues to enhance collaborative naval monitoring initiatives, while Asia-Pacific nations are rapidly strengthening coastal defense systems.

As maritime security challenges evolve, the integration of advanced monitoring capabilities will remain central to the sustained growth of the Anti Submarine Warfare Market.

1. Why is maritime surveillance critical in anti-submarine warfare?
It enables early detection of underwater threats and enhances situational awareness for naval operations.

2. Which technologies are used in maritime surveillance?
Radar systems, sonar arrays, satellites, AI-based analytics, and unmanned platforms are commonly used.
